He also is director of the Marion Bessin Liver Research Center and the Herman Lopata chair in liver disease research. Dr. Wolkoff is associate chair of research at the medical school’s department of medicine and a professor of hepatology who teaches in the anatomy and structural biology department.
For two years, Dr. Wolkoff was a clinical associate in gastroenterology-hepatology in the digestive disease branch of the National Institute of Arthritis, Metabolism and Digestive Disease.
